Since 2006, Amazon Web Services (AWS) has changed the way companies acquire and use technology by providing a highly scalable, secure, cost-effective, and flexible technology platform in the cloud. Our global team manages AWS’s reputation as the world’s leading AI and cloud provider. We use storytelling across all channels to shape perception with community members, customers, C-suite decision-makers, developers, employees, influencers, media, partners, policymakers, recruits, regulators, and startup founders. We support the growth of the business and adoption of AWS technologies by demonstrating how customers and partners are transforming organizations and industries, and through these efforts, we reinforce Amazon’s position as a leader in innovation.
The AWS Global Communications team is seeking a lead Executive Assistant (EA) to provide dedicated, high-level administrative and strategic support to the Director of Global Communications, a direct report to the SVP of Communications and Corporate Responsibility of Amazon. This critical role requires strong organizational skills, excellent judgment, attention to detail, and the ability to prioritize competing demands while maintaining a strong bias for action.
You will serve as the gatekeeper between the Director and internal/external stakeholders, ensuring seamless communication. The role involves frequent interaction with business and technology leaders, support teams, and EAs at the highest levels of the company. Given the direct line to senior leaders, this role demands someone who can operate with minimal guidance, anticipate needs, and represent the Director's office with executive presence and precision.

Key job responsibilities
- Independently own and optimize a complex executive calendar across multiple time zones; make judgment calls on prioritization, proactively protect focus time, and anticipate scheduling needs based on business cadence and leadership priorities.
- Serve as a trusted proxy; independently triage and respond to requests, manage sensitive communications with discretion, and build strong relationships with internal and external stakeholders at all levels.
- Coordinate domestic and international travel, including flights, hotels, ground transportation, and detailed itineraries as appropriate. Manage expense reconciliation and tracking in compliance with Amazon policies.
- Own recurring operational mechanisms (e.g., team meetings, business reviews, org-wide communications) end-to-end; identify inefficiencies and implement process improvements, making smart use of AI tools.
